Access to Numerous Financing Avenues: The Lowdown

The standout perk of incorporation has to be the myriad of financing options available. Unlike sole proprietorships or partnerships, corporations can roll out different classes of shares. This flexibility? It opens the door for investments from both public and private sectors alike. It’s like having a VIP pass to the financial world, giving you access to loan options or investors who are eager to join your venture.

Banks and financial institutions often give incorporated businesses a nod of approval because of their perceived stability. They come equipped with structures that allow for accountability and growth. Picture this: securing funding becomes much easier when you’re seen as a credible, well-managed entity. Capital is the lifeblood of any business, and having robust financing avenues can significantly influence your growth trajectory.

Professional Management: Set Yourself Apart

Then there's the element of professional management, which often enhances the operation of a business. Bigger corporations frequently turn to seasoned professionals to steer the ship. It’s akin to switching from driving a go-kart to hopping into a sleek sports car. The advantages of having skilled management translate to improved operational efficiency. But again, here’s where the financing edge shines brighter because a robust management team without adequate funding can only take you so far.
